Alchemy and Enchanting were great skills to have. If they have them along with basic fighting skills, they could be a great adventurer. However, that would be just as bad as when Limerick Jill sent her Omega Warriors across to the shrine. They would most likely be the last line of defense for the town. If they got past the Protectors, they would be obliterated by my kids. A Tac pack came up to the gates of the town and they wanted to get some of their things back from an adventurer that stole it. It came from the brown tribe this time which was a surprise. The Doat mayor decided to face them all in combat. They agreed and the Doat leaped down to meet them. He then beat the shit out of all of them. He had no shred of mercy and killed them all. I was impressed. He jumped back up to me on the walls. That startled me because we were over 30 feet up. He chuckled and said "Did you like what you see, Sage?" he asked. I nodded and said "It was great. Keep it up mayor. We're all counting on you to help keep us safe." He just scoffed once. "You better work too." he said and leaped away.

Jumping around like that would be pretty cool. I could still kill him though. Since there was time to kill, I wanted to visit the Ekans used as breeding stock in the white tribe again. The egg she laid had a son in it. He was mostly white. A series rings of dark green ran along the entire length of his body. The Ynnub tribe had tied him up as well for safety. Side by side, they were laid together with posts in the ground. I was not quite sure that this was safe. I could see them finding a way to get out of this situation and escaping. I shrugged and began to leave. "Wait." the female said. I stopped and turned to her again. "Yes!? What is it!?" I asked. I was curious as to what she would say to me. "It's been more than enough. Release me already." she said. I said "I told you what the consequences would be. Why should I let you go? You'll just attack the town again." She looked at me and said "I swear that I won't attack this village or town." I pointed at the smaller male and asked "What should we do with your son?" She just hissed and said "Do whatever you want. That whelp is not worthy of his scales."

Keeping him would not be much of a problem. I already had a stable of 11. I also did not have use for her 2 siblings either. Leaning over her, I said "I can let you go. Take your siblings with you and go far away. If you come back to us, we will kill you. Do you understand?" She nodded and I released her from the posts. She rubbed both her wrists and waited for me to untie her son. I told the Ynnub nearby to give us space. I led them to the den and they had their reunion. She explained what happened to her. They then explained what happened to them. I then led the 3 of them to the gate and watched them leave. I named the abandoned son Circles and let him live with the rest of the kids in the den. He was the most submissive and docile of the bunch. I had to be the most partial to him because even Mack, Meck, Mick, and Muck would bully him. Circles was also substantially weaker. He did not have my blood flowing in me after all. With the adults gone, the mayor would pass by much more often. Then he would approach and look them over. I looked from a distance to keep them safe.

I was sure that my kids would be fine. Circles would be killed for sure. The Daot was very upset with the enchanter and alchemy tables. He accused me of trying to usurp him. "I am the Sage and I was here before you. It really is no different to me whether or not you are here." I told him. He smiled menacingly and said. "I don't think this is something that is needed. Why don't you take this down?" Looking him in the eye, I said "A town without it will be much weaker. You don't want to be the one to do all of the battles, right!?" Random Ynnubs would come over to see what it was. They were mostly from the red and yellow tribes. I explained it to them and some wanted to try it out. I let them do it and the ones that were good could come back and bring their friends. We had Elitpers, Doats, Ynnubs and the Ekans in town. There were people of all races that wanted to use them. Since I had the supplies for the tables set to infinite, I had no problem letting them try. Only the ones that wanted to do it came. Only the good ones stayed long. This gave us some novice enchanters and alchemist.
